* hw/pci-host: pnv_phb{3, 4}: Fix heap out-of-bound access failureXuzhou Cheng2022-09-201-0/+1
| | | | | | | | | | | | | | | | | | | | | pnv_phb3_root_bus_info and pnv_phb4_root_bus_info are missing the instance_size initialization. This results in accessing out-of-bound memory when setting 'chip-id' and 'phb-id', and eventually crashes glib's malloc functionality with the following message: "qemu-system-ppc64: GLib: ../glib-2.72.3/glib/gmem.c:131: failed to allocate 3232 bytes" This issue was noticed only when running qtests with QEMU Windows 32-bit executable. Windows 64-bit, Linux 32/64-bit do not expose this bug though. * ppc/pnv: add phb-id/chip-id PnvPHB3RootBus propertiesDaniel Henrique Barboza2022-08-311-0/+50
| | | | | | | | | | | | | | | | | | | | | | | | | We rely on the phb-id and chip-id, which are PHB properties, to assign chassis and slot to the root port. For default devices this is no big deal: the root port is being created under pnv_phb_realize() and the values are being passed on via the 'index' and 'chip-id' of the pnv_phb_attach_root_port() helper. If we want to implement user created root ports we have a problem. The user created root port will not be aware of which PHB it belongs to, unless we're willing to violate QOM best practices and access the PHB via dev->parent_bus->parent. What we can do is to access the root bus parent bus. Since we're already assigning the root port as QOM child of the bus, and the bus is initiated using PHB properties, let's add phb-id and chip-id as properties of the bus. This will allow us trivial access to them, for both user-created and default root ports, without doing anything too shady with QOM. * ppc/pnv: Remove LSI on the PCIE host bridgeFrederic Barrat2022-04-201-0/+1
| | | | | | | | | | | | | | | | | The phb3/phb4/phb5 root ports inherit from the default PCIE root port implementation, which requests a LSI interrupt (#INTA). On real hardware (POWER8/POWER9/POWER10), there is no such LSI. This patch corrects it so that it matches the hardware. As a consequence, the device tree previously generated was bogus, as the root bridge LSI was not properly mapped. On some implementation (powernv9), it was leading to inconsistent interrupt controller (xive) data. With this patch, it is now clean. * Use g_new() & friends where that makes obvious senseMarkus Armbruster2022-03-211-1/+1
| | | | | | | | | | | | | | | | | | | | | | | g_new(T, n) is neater than g_malloc(sizeof(T) * n). It's also safer, for two reasons. One, it catches multiplication overflowing size_t. Two, it returns T * rather than void *, which lets the compiler catch more type errors. This commit only touches allocations with size arguments of the form sizeof(T). * ppc/pnv: Remove user-created PHB{3,4,5} devicesCédric Le Goater2022-03-141-30/+3
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| On a real system with POWER{8,9,10} processors, PHBs are sub-units of the processor, they can be deactivated by firmware but not plugged in or out like a PCI adapter on a slot. Nevertheless, having user-created PHBs in QEMU seemed to be a good idea for testing purposes : 1. having a limited set of PHBs speedups boot time. 2. it is useful to be able to mimic a partially broken topology you some time have to deal with during bring-up. PowerNV is also used for distro install tests and having libvirt support eases these tasks. libvirt prefers to run the machine with -nodefaults to be sure not to drag unexpected devices which would need to be defined in the domain file without being specified on the QEMU command line. For this reason : 3. -nodefaults should not include default PHBs User-created PHB{3,4,5} devices satisfied all these needs but reality proves to be a bit more complex, internally when modeling such devices, and externally when dealing with the user interface. Req 1. and 2. can be simply addressed differently with a machine option: "phb-mask=<uint>", which QEMU would use to enable/disable PHB device nodes when creating the device tree. For Req 3., we need to make sure we are taking the right approach. It seems that we should expose a new type of user-created PHB device, a generic virtualized one, that libvirt would use and not one depending on the processor revision. This needs more thinking. For now, remove user-created PHB{3,4,5} devices. All the cleanups we did are not lost and they will be useful for the next steps. * ppc/pnv: use a do-while() loop in pnv_phb3_translate_tve()Daniel Henrique Barboza2022-01-281-2/+4
| | | | | | | | | | | | | | | | | | | | | | | | | | The 'taddr' variable is left unintialized, being set only inside the "while ((lev--) >= 0)" loop where we get the TCE address. The 'lev' var is an int32_t that is being initiliazed by the GETFIELD() macro, which returns an uint64_t. For a human reader this means that 'lev' will always be positive or zero. But some compilers may beg to differ. 'lev' being an int32_t can in theory be set as negative, and the "while ((lev--) >= 0)" loop might never be reached, and 'taddr' will be left unitialized. This can cause phb3_error() to use 'taddr' uninitialized down below: if ((is_write & !(tce & 2)) || ((!is_write) && !(tce & 1))) { phb3_error(phb, "TCE access fault at 0x%"PRIx64, taddr); A quick way of fixing it is to use a do/while() loop. This will keep the same semanting as the existing while() loop does and the compiler will understand that 'taddr' will be initialized at least once. Suggested-by: Matheus K. * pnv_phb3.c: add unique chassis and slot for pnv_phb3_root_portDaniel Henrique Barboza2022-01-121-0/+16
| | | | | | | | | | | | | | | | | | | | | | | | | When creating a pnv_phb3_root_port using the command line, the first root port is created successfully, but the second fails with the following error: qemu-system-ppc64: -device pnv-phb3-root-port,bus=phb3-root.0,id=pcie.3: Can't add chassis slot, error -16 This error comes from the realize() function of its parent type, rp_realize() from TYPE_PCIE_ROOT_PORT. pcie_chassis_add_slot() fails with -EBUSY if there's an existing PCIESlot that has the same chassis/slot value, regardless of being in a different bus. One way to prevent this error is simply set chassis and slot values in the command line. However, since phb3 root buses only supports a single root port, we can just get an unique chassis/slot value by checking which root bus the pnv_phb3_root_port is going to be attached, get the equivalent phb3 device and use its chip-id and index values, which are guaranteed to be unique. * pnv_phb3.c: do not set 'root-bus' as bus nameDaniel Henrique Barboza2022-01-041-1/+2
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| All pnv-phb3-root-bus buses are being created as 'root-bus'. This makes it impossible to, for example, add a pnv-phb3-root-port in a specific root bus, since they all have the same name. By default the device will be parented by the pnv-phb3 device that precedeced it in the QEMU command line. Moreover, this doesn't all for custom bus naming. Libvirt, for instance, likes to name these buses as 'pcie.N', where 'N' is the index value of the controller in the domain XML, by using the 'id' command line attribute. At this moment this is also being ignored - the created root bus will always be named 'root-bus'. This patch fixes both scenarios by removing the 'root-bus' name from the pci_register_root_bus() call. If an "id" is provided, use that. Otherwise use 'NULL' as bus name. The 'NULL' value will be handled in qbus_init_internal() and it will defaulted as lowercase bus type + the global bus_id value. * ppc/pnv: Add models for POWER8 PHB3 PCIe Host bridgeCédric Le Goater2020-02-021-0/+1195
This is a model of the PCIe Host Bridge (PHB3) found on a POWER8 processor. It includes the PowerBus logic interface (PBCQ), IOMMU support, a single PCIe Gen.3 Root Complex, and support for MSI and LSI interrupt sources as found on a POWER8 system using the XICS interrupt controller. The POWER8 processor comes in different flavors: Venice, Murano, Naple, each having a different number of PHBs. To make things simpler, the models provides 3 PHB3 per chip. Some platforms, like the Firestone, can also couple PHBs on the first chip to provide more bandwidth but this is too specific to model in QEMU. XICS requires some adjustment to support the PHB3 MSI. The changes are provided here but they could be decoupled in prereq patches.
